What Are Stablecoins?
Stablecoins are cryptocurrencies designed to maintain a stable value, typically by pegging them to assets like the US Dollar. Unlike other c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in or Ethereum, which experience significant price fluctuations, stablecoins aim for a consistent valuation. This stability makes them an attractive option for various applications, from daily transactions to large-scale financial operations.
Mechanisms of Stability
Stablecoins come in two primary varieties: fully collateralized and algorithmic.
Fully Collateralized: These stablecoins, like Tether (USDT) and Paxos Standard (PAX), are secured by reserves of assets that match the amount of stablecoins in circulation. For instance, if 1 USDT is issued, it is backed by $1 in reserves, which could be in the form of cash, government bonds, or other approved assets.
Algorithmic: These stablecoins, such as Algorand's AlgoUSD, use smart contracts and algorithms to stabilize their value. By adjusting the supply of the coin based on market conditions, they aim to keep prices steady. Though less common, algorithmic stablecoins are gaining traction due to their innovative approach.
The Role of Blockchain Technology
Blockchain technology underpins the functionality of stablecoins. The decentralized nature of blockchain ensures transparency and security, which are crucial for maintaining trust in stablecoin transactions. Through smart contracts, stablecoins can be minted and burned automatically, ensuring the peg to the backing asset is maintained.
Stablecoins in Financial Infrastructure
Stablecoins are revolutionizing financial infrastructure by providing a stable medium of exchange, facilitating cross-border transactions, and enabling new financial products.
Medium of Exchange: Stablecoins offer a reliable alternative to traditional currencies, making microtransactions and small-value transfers more efficient and cost-effective. This is especially beneficial in regions with unstable local currencies.
Cross-Border Transactions: The global nature of blockchain technology allows stablecoins to streamline cross-border payments, reducing the time and cost associated with traditional banking systems. This capability is transforming remittances and international trade.
New Financial Products: Stablecoins are the foundation for various financial products, including decentralized finance (DeFi) applications. From lending and borrowing platforms to yield farming and liquidity pools, stablecoins enable a wide array of innovative financial services.

The Unmatched Flexibility of Smart Contracts
One of the most compelling AA Ethereum benefits is the platform’s ability to execute smart contracts. Unlike traditional contracts, which rely on intermediaries and are prone to delays and human error, smart contracts on Ethereum are self-executing with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. This innovation ensures transparency, reduces costs, and eliminates the need for third parties, thereby increasing efficiency and trust.
Imagine a real estate transaction. With Ethereum, the entire process—from property transfer to payment—can be encoded into a smart contract. Once all conditions are met, the contract automatically executes, ensuring that all parties receive their due promptly and transparently. This level of automation and security is a game-changer, streamlining processes that previously took months to complete.

Enhanced Security and Data Privacy
Security is a paramount concern in any digital ecosystem, and Ethereum excels in this area. The platform’s consensus mechanism, Proof of Work (PoW), ensures that the network is secure and resistant to attacks. Furthermore, Ethereum 2.0, the next-generation upgrade, is transitioning to Proof of Stake (PoS), which promises even greater security, efficiency, and sustainability.
In terms of data privacy, Ethereum’s blockchain is designed to be transparent, but it also offers solutions for private transactions. Tools like zk-SNARKs (Zero-Knowledge Succinct Non-Interactive Argument of Knowledge) allow for private transactions without compromising the integrity of the blockchain. This means that users can conduct financial transactions and engage in dApps without exposing their private information to the public.
